]> git.ipfire.org Git - thirdparty/sqlite.git/commitdiff
Sync to trunk
authorlarrybr <larrybr@noemail.net>
Mon, 31 Jan 2022 19:52:30 +0000 (19:52 +0000)
committerlarrybr <larrybr@noemail.net>
Mon, 31 Jan 2022 19:52:30 +0000 (19:52 +0000)
FossilOrigin-Name: f51a17b6271a8dd7c48725e4ec2df1fde0460866c81c7225dc27216ab389591e

1  2 
manifest
manifest.uuid
src/shell.c.in

diff --cc manifest
index 1fdb6dec8be45517c7bf804fa8000fa7da196797,3fd894d1bc4cf452dc618b40ecdcdfbf8ed043de..7988d191d1c8cb24758a85f0612d77289596f72d
+++ b/manifest
@@@ -1,5 -1,5 +1,5 @@@
- C Cleanup\sdot-command\shandling,\smake\smulti-line\swork,\shonor\sexit\srequests\sfrom\smore\scontexts
- D 2022-01-31T19:23:32.887
 -C Fix\sharmless\scompiler\swarnings\sin\sMSVC.
 -D 2022-01-31T16:29:06.213
++C Sync\sto\strunk
++D 2022-01-31T19:52:30.524
  F .fossil-settings/empty-dirs dbb81e8fc0401ac46a1491ab34a7f2c7c0452f2f06b54ebb845d024ca8283ef1
  F .fossil-settings/ignore-glob 35175cdfcf539b2318cb04a9901442804be81cd677d8b889fcc9149c21f239ea
  F LICENSE.md df5091916dbb40e6e9686186587125e1b2ff51f022cc334e886c19a0e9982724
@@@ -553,7 -553,7 +553,7 @@@ F src/random.c 097dc8b31b8fba5a9aca1697
  F src/resolve.c 24032ae57aec10df2f3fa2e20be0aae7d256bc704124b76c52d763440c7c0fe9
  F src/rowset.c ba9515a922af32abe1f7d39406b9d35730ed65efab9443dc5702693b60854c92
  F src/select.c a6d2d4bed279d7fe4fcedaf297eaf6441e8e17c6e3947a32d24d23be52ac02f2
- F src/shell.c.in 4424f30c3b6fa8075da6edf8657895851d95133535af489249d9f6fd31b3ac1a
 -F src/shell.c.in 252de95a2ba4ab1808b2bacc00644389a72c61ffd61c7193e5b319cc126a5c52
++F src/shell.c.in 55d2161e0da793ad38c84e391f6aebf81e687ab3e8389d9c51dd05e3ebef0c45
  F src/sqlite.h.in eaade58049152dac850d57415bcced885ca27ae9582f8aea2cfb7f1db78a521b
  F src/sqlite3.rc 5121c9e10c3964d5755191c80dd1180c122fc3a8
  F src/sqlite3ext.h 5d54cf13d3406d8eb65d921a0d3c349de6126b732e695e79ecd4830ce86b4f8a
@@@ -1386,10 -1386,10 +1386,10 @@@ F test/sharedA.test 49d87ec54ab640fbbc3
  F test/sharedB.test 16cc7178e20965d75278f410943109b77b2e645e
  F test/shared_err.test 32634e404a3317eeb94abc7a099c556a346fdb8fb3858dbe222a4cbb8926a939
  F test/sharedlock.test 5ede3c37439067c43b0198f580fd374ebf15d304
- F test/shell1.test 70f46b5d07776a107335c3c2c9cbd0431d44637bfeae1f6b9ded5e33b4c7c0bf
+ F test/shell1.test ce2f370886645f38fabdde44976c14a004400f166edea8fdd9741079b645fef6
  F test/shell2.test f00a0501c00583cbc46f7510e1d713366326b2b3e63d06d15937284171a8787c
 -F test/shell3.test cb4b835a901742c9719437a89171172ecc4a8823ad97349af8e4e841e6f82566
 -F test/shell4.test 8f6c0fce4abed19a8a7f7262517149812a04caa905d01bdc8f5e92573504b759
 +F test/shell3.test 3fed756f9e254d638b012fc018f5125e2f15bf79a824a4f474405b3aad9f0fb8
 +F test/shell4.test 823b84d39d4dc7a78b7570342b7e43dc32805fa8ee92e5b40a89775c3170dac1
  F test/shell5.test b85069bfcf3159b225228629ab2c3e69aa923d098fea8ea074b5dcd743522e2c
  F test/shell6.test 1ceb51b2678c472ba6cf1e5da96679ce8347889fe2c3bf93a0e0fa73f00b00d3
  F test/shell7.test 115132f66d0463417f408562cc2cf534f6bbc6d83a6d50f0072a9eb171bae97f
@@@ -1942,8 -1942,8 +1942,8 @@@ F vsixtest/vsixtest.tcl 6a9a6ab600c25a9
  F vsixtest/vsixtest.vcxproj.data 2ed517e100c66dc455b492e1a33350c1b20fbcdc
  F vsixtest/vsixtest.vcxproj.filters 37e51ffedcdb064aad6ff33b6148725226cd608e
  F vsixtest/vsixtest_TemporaryKey.pfx e5b1b036facdb453873e7084e1cae9102ccc67a0
- P 59693d3e732bbfd4855d97c55e91ad3fbc9d22ebd2c073c5debe958e8100c93e
- R 183362d79d916a1a03ae235575ff10ea
 -P f8766231d2a77bb8b95726b514736d4c2d20b056f7fe60bdbc98ebf5e5b15ae9
 -R 6c51010444b3de981e88513b2160fc76
 -U drh
 -Z 405a35ed61d67534b5e5df8c9cf5fafe
++P 5cf66e89071b619d116a4707b6ff1cd7917edffe5ab504514f37da433a77b61d 3ec6141c41a71eea0d96a65aa35c828e4d852d60e090513c312b925d0e257f9a
++R 8a6470510b0d975aef4cae0efde55caf
 +U larrybr
- Z add4c9190edfa3f82cfa473c5298219b
++Z adeafb366e133cc01524fb4c6c546d1f
  # Remove this line to create a well-formed Fossil manifest.
diff --cc manifest.uuid
index b3e64aea77180ee8cb866089f1e55ebc6d58a108,0fd822b0912f724321d8250253e007796ffa4628..815cba63882106e825897d59fd91458b9348766d
@@@ -1,1 -1,1 +1,1 @@@
- 5cf66e89071b619d116a4707b6ff1cd7917edffe5ab504514f37da433a77b61d
 -3ec6141c41a71eea0d96a65aa35c828e4d852d60e090513c312b925d0e257f9a
++f51a17b6271a8dd7c48725e4ec2df1fde0460866c81c7225dc27216ab389591e
diff --cc src/shell.c.in
index 60deebf09a6d62ca5258549f16f33c8761aa3890,c53b9104ff6f47aff484b5135a520e34b39d3e64..42149f77868fd26d74f369fa407295c266bc6755
@@@ -1219,8 -1084,9 +1219,10 @@@ struct ShellState 
    u8 eTraceType;         /* SHELL_TRACE_* value for type of trace */
    u8 bSafeMode;          /* True to prohibit unsafe operations */
    u8 bSafeModePersist;   /* The long-term value of bSafeMode */
 -  u8 bQuote;             /* Quote results for .mode box and table */
 -  int iWrap;             /* Wrap lines this long or longer in some output modes */
 +  u8 bExtendedDotCmds;   /* Bits set to enable various shell extensions */
    unsigned statsOn;      /* True to display memory stats before each finalize */
++  u8 bQuote;             /* Quote results for .mode box and table */
++  int iWrap;             /* In columnar modes, wrap lines reaching this limit */
    unsigned mEqpLines;    /* Mask of veritical lines in the EQP output graph */
    int inputNesting;      /* Track nesting level of .read and other redirects */
    int outCount;          /* Revert to stdout when reaching zero */